Rs.16,000 is given to a person for 2 years on 10% interest what be the compound interest
---------------
A(t) = P(1+(r/n))^(nt)
----
A(2) = 16000(1+(0.1/1))^(1*2)
----
A(2) = 16000(1+0.1)^2
--
A(2) = 16000(1.1^2)
A(2) = 19360
---
Interest earned = 19360-16000 = 3360
